Abstract

PURPOSE: To surely take out slender drugs one by one such as ampuls and the like which are housed in a drug housing container at random, without being impaired. CONSTITUTION: The bottom wall 2 of a drug housing container 1 is inclined in such a way as to be lowered to its one side, combteeth 3 are formed at the lowermost section, and an ampul fall prevention pawl 4 is provided for the tip end section of the combteeth 3. A great number of ampuls are housed in the drug housing container 1, and two pickers 5 and 6 provided with a plurality of stages for a teeth shaped fork 7 capable of holding only one ampul, are compositely moved up and down and in the front and rear directions. When the fork 7 at the lowermost stage of the picker 5 or 6 passes through a space between the combteeth 3, an ampul positioned over the combteeth 3 is picked up by the fork 7, when the forks 7 of both the pickers 5 and 6 mutually pass through, the ample is alternately delivered to the fork 7 at the upper stage side between both the pickers 5 and 6, and when the amplul is brought up to the uppermost stage of the picker 6, let the amplul be rolled over to one direction by the inclination of the fork 7, and it is thereby delivered over to a delivery chute 12.

Embodiments of the present invention will be described below with reference to the accompanying drawings. As shown in FIGS. 1 to 4, for example, taking out an ampoule as an example will now be described. A medicine storage container 1 that stores a large number of ampoules at random is inclined so that a bottom wall 2 becomes lower toward one side. Then, the comb teeth 3 are formed at the lowest portion of the bottom wall 2, and the tip of the comb teeth 3 is provided with a claw 4 for preventing an ampoule drop. At the center of the bottom wall 2, a stirrer S for disentangling the overlapping ampoules is provided.

A pair of pickers 5 and 6 are provided on the sides of the comb teeth 3 of the medicine container 1, and comb-shaped forks 7 are vertically arranged in a plurality of steps on one side surface of each of the pickers 5 and 6. It is provided at intervals. Only one ampoule can be placed on the forks 7 of each stage, and each fork 7 is inclined so that the base is lower than the tip end in order to prevent the placed ampule from falling. .

Cams 8 are in contact with the bottom surfaces of the pickers 5 and 6, respectively. On the other hand, two push rods 9 extending in the horizontal direction are provided on the other side surface of each of the pickers 5 and 6 at intervals in the vertical direction, and the pulling force of a spring 10 connected to the other side surface of each of the pickers 5 and 6 causes The cam 11 is in contact with the end surface of the push rod 9. As the cams 8 and 11 rotate, the pickers 5 and 6 perform a combined motion in the up-down direction and the front-rear direction while drawing a locus that approximates an ellipse. The phase of the picker 5 and the picker 6 in this combined motion is 180 °
Deviated.

The uppermost fork 7 of the picker 6 extends in the direction of the discharge chute 12 located on the side of the upper end of the picker 6 and can pass between the comb teeth 13 formed at the end of the discharge chute 12. Has become. The discharge chute 12 is provided with a sensor PH that detects passage of an ampoule.

In the ampoule take-out device having the above structure, the lowermost fork 7 of the picker 5 or the picker 6 is used.
When is passed between the comb teeth 3 of the medicine storage container 1, of the ampules stored in the medicine storage container 1, the ampule located on the comb teeth 3 is picked up by the fork 7. And the ampoule is a fork 7 of both pickers 5, 6.
When they pass each other, they are alternately delivered to the upper fork 7 between the pickers 5 and 6, and when they reach the uppermost fork 7 of the picker 6, they roll in one direction due to the inclination of the fork 7 and are discharged. It is discharged onto the chute 12. Sensor PH
When the passage of a preset number of ampules is detected, the rotation of the cams 8 and 11 is stopped and the removal of the ampules is completed.
